The Share Agreement Contract for Services in Hillsborough is designed for parties entering into an equity-sharing venture regarding a residential property. The agreement outlines the terms of purchase, including the total purchase price, down payment contributions from each investor, and the financing details. Key features include the establishment of the equity-sharing venture, maintenance responsibilities of the parties, and specific provisions for the distribution of proceeds upon the sale of the property. It also addresses future capital contributions, potential loans between parties, and stipulates that any disputes will be resolved through binding arbitration. A person can file a quitclaim deed by (1) entering the relevant information on a quitclaim deed form, (2) signing the deed with two witnesses and a notary, and (3) recording the deed at the county comptroller's office. In Florida, quitclaim deeds must have the name and address of both the grantor and the grantee.

The Hillsborough County Domestic Partnership Registry was established to provide benefits for unmarried residents. Unmarried residents who are registered in Domestic Partnership Registry and decide to marry in the future should file a notice of Domestic Partnership termination in the registry at the time of marriage.

In Florida, there is no statewide recognition of domestic partnership. Only the counties of Palm Beach, Volusia, Broward, Orange, Pinellas, Miami-Dade, Leon, Monroe, and Sarasota recognize domestic partnerships, enabling legal benefits for those couples.
